Truckload Intermodal Cost Indexes for the 1st Quarter of 2016

2016-04-27

For the first quarter 2016, the Cass Transportation Indexes, which are being used to monitor and evaluate U.S. inland rates, reflected an average of 125.3 for the Truckload Linehaul Index and 127.9 for the Intermodal Price Index (rail). Compared to the established baselines, neither of the indexes reflected a change exceeding the threshold (+/- 2 percent), therefore the inland rates will remain unchanged through the second quarter of 2016.
